linux监控日志命令
时间: 2023-04-15 11:01:03 浏览: 144
Linux 监控日志命令有很多,以下是一些常用的:
1. tail:实时查看日志文件的最后几行,可以使用 -f 参数实时监控日志文件的变化。
2. grep:在日志文件中查找指定的关键字,可以使用 -i 参数忽略大小写。
3. awk:对日志文件进行分析和处理,可以使用各种条件和操作符进行过滤和计算。
4. sed:对日志文件进行编辑和替换,可以使用正则表达式进行匹配和替换。
5. less:以分页的方式查看日志文件,可以使用 / 关键字进行搜索。
6. watch:周期性地查看日志文件的变化,可以使用 -n 参数指定时间间隔。
7. journalctl:查看系统日志,可以使用各种参数进行过滤和查询。
8. dmesg:查看内核日志,可以了解系统启动和运行过程中的错误和警告信息。
9. lsof:查看打开的文件和进程,可以用于排查文件被占用的问题。
10. netstat:查看网络连接和端口状态,可以用于排查网络问题。
相关问题
linux实时监控日志命令
Linux实时监控日志的命令有多种,其中比较常用的包括:
1. tail命令:可以实时查看日志文件的最新内容,常用的参数包括-f(跟踪文件)和-n(显示最后n行)。
2. grep命令:可以根据关键字过滤日志文件中的内容,常用的参数包括-i(忽略大小写)和-v(反向匹配)。
3. watch命令:可以定时执行其他命令,并将结果输出到终端,常用于实时监控系统状态和日志文件。
4. multitail命令:可以同时监控多个日志文件,并将它们合并显示在同一个终端窗口中,支持多种过滤和高亮显示功能。
5. lnav命令:是一款功能强大的日志查看工具,支持多种日志格式和过滤方式,可以实现实时监控、搜索、统计等功能。
linux抓取日志的命令
Linux抓取日志的命令有很多,以下是一些常用的:
1. tail命令:用于查看文件的末尾内容,可以实时监控日志文件的变化。
2. grep命令:用于在文件中查找指定的字符串,可以用来过滤日志文件中的内容。
3. awk命令:用于处理文本文件,可以对日志文件进行分析和统计。
4. sed命令:用于对文本文件进行编辑,可以用来修改日志文件中的内容。
5. cat命令:用于查看文件的内容,可以用来查看日志文件的内容。
6. less命令:用于查看文件的内容,可以用来查看大型日志文件的内容。
7. tailf命令:用于实时监控日志文件的变化,类似于tail命令,但更加实时。
8. journalctl命令:用于查看系统日志,可以查看系统各个服务的日志信息。
9. dmesg命令:用于查看内核日志,可以查看系统内核的日志信息。
以上是一些常用的Linux抓取日志的命令,可以根据需要选择使用。
阅读全文